A Unified Global Effort to Protect and Promote Naturist Rights

SYDNEY - Washingtoner -- In the face of growing challenges to naturist rights, NaturismRE, the Australian Naturist Federation (ANF), and Get Naked Australia (GNA) have come together to support the 2025 Australia public Decency & Nudity Bill—a crucial step toward protecting the rights of naturists and nudists in Australia. While these organisations operate with distinct missions, they recognise that when fundamental freedoms are at stake, unity is essential.

NaturismRE, a modern movement advocating for naturist rights through legal activism, technological innovation, and global community-building, has reached out to INF-FNI (International Naturist Federation) to invite their collaboration on this Bill. The goal is to foster a broader alliance that supports the rights of naturists worldwide, ensuring a unified and constructive approach to advocacy.

"What is happening in Australia today will be replicated worldwide," says Vincent Marty - Founder of NaturismRE (NRE) - The Naturism REsurgence, Founder of NaturismRE. "This is about setting a precedent—demonstrating that when necessary, naturist organisations can work together to defend the rights of those who choose a clothes-free lifestyle."

International Backing Grows The momentum behind the Decency Bill is not limited to Australia. NaturismRE is proud to announce that Clothes Free International, a well-established global organisation advocating for naturist rights and body freedom, has expressed interest in supporting this initiative. Additionally, the Naturist Association of Thailand has already confirmed their commitment to promoting and backing the Bill. These endorsements demonstrate that the push for naturist rights transcends borders and has the potential to create lasting change worldwide.

Support from ANF The Australian Naturist Federation (ANF) has a commitment to raising awareness for the naturist lifestyle. "Our mission is to 'Normalise Nudity,'" says Shazz, President of ANF. "We only want people to understand choices, and without judgement, for us to enjoy the areas naturists can use. Body positivity and freedom of choice within social nudism is our goal. With this in mind, we are supporting the Bill and Petition for the 'Australian Public Decency and Nudity Clarification Bill 2025' with our community."

A Unified Front, Yet Independent Paths Each organisation supporting this initiative remains independent, operating under its unique philosophy and approach. NaturismRE, ANF, and GNA complement each other, bringing different strengths to the movement. Unifying for a cause does not mean surrendering autonomy—it means recognising the bigger picture and standing together when rights are at risk.

A Global Call to Action: NaturismRE hopes that INF-FNI and other international federations will join this effort. Whether they choose to do so or not, this movement will continue to grow beyond Australia, setting a blueprint for future legal battles to secure naturist rights worldwide.

"We are not here to replace any organisation—we are here to ensure naturism evolves, expands, and gains the recognition it deserves. What we accomplish today in Australia can serve as a model for other nations where naturists still face legal restrictions."

NaturismRE invites all like-minded individuals and organisations—naturist clubs, associations, activists, and independent supporters worldwide—to rally behind this cause and contribute to the fight for a world where naturists can live freely, without discrimination or fear.
